RE. BODIES. X.5830
X.5380

We wired you today to send the subframe to Lillie Hall, and also to say that all the holes for the fixing of the runners should be drilled at Derby.

Owing to the impossibility of completing a new body on a subframe by the date fixed we have been forced to purchase a close coupled four-seater semi-flexible body from Barkers. This body will be mounted on body brackets and is being altered to suit the new chassis dimensions.

The first chassis should not have the subframe brackets, but a set of standard brackets fixed in positions which we will tell you about by a drg. now in progress. This drg. will also shew the step-irons, and side lever positions. Few new pieces are needed.

The body will be ready by the middle of July, when it should be arranged for it to be collected by lorry. We shall let you have the wings and valances as soon as possible before that date as they will have to be fitted and painted at Derby.

The subframe will go to Hoopers where we are putting in hand the second body, a six-seater sedanca.

The third body, a close coupled all-weather, which is the real body for R.{Sir Henry Royce}, will be built at Barkers on the lines adopted for the sports open bodies.

So far as we can see we shall only need the one subframe to begin with.
